Update: 8:39 p.m.

Heather Flynn has been located and has told authorities that she is OK, according to a press release from the Kent Police Department.

Original

Kent Police are investigating a missing Kent State student. Heather Flynn, 24, was last seen at the library on Tuesday, according to Flynn’s friend Matthew Ansell. Flynn’s family filed a missing persons report after not hearing from her for three days.
